The second round of the UAE Jet Ski Championship will take place on 15th and 16th November at the scenic Abu Dhabi Corniche, promising a weekend full of high-speed excitement and international competition. The event is organised by the Abu Dhabi Marine Sports Club and held under the supervision of the UAE Marine Sports Federation as part of the 2025 national marine sports calendar.

This year’s competition will include several racing categories, ensuring that both seasoned professionals and emerging talents have the chance to compete. The categories include:
Stand-Up Professional (GP1)
Stand-Up Junior (GP2)
Sit-Down Professional (GP2)
Sit-Down Novice (GP3)
Sit-Down Spark (GP4)
Freestyle Show (Freestyle category)
Junior categories (3.1, 3.2, and 3.3)
Each race will test the riders’ speed, control, and endurance, offering spectators an exciting display of athleticism and skill on the water.
The event will begin on Friday, 15th November, with the registration of participants, followed by technical inspections to ensure all jet skis meet safety and performance standards. Riders will then attend a briefing session to review race routes, regulations, and safety measures.
The first stage of racing will start on Saturday morning, featuring intense qualifying rounds across all categories. On Sunday, the second stage will take place, determining the final standings. The championship will conclude with an official awards ceremony, where the winners will be crowned in front of fans, media, and sports officials.
